Foundation Crack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ious problems?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; some are cosmetic, but larger or growing cracks should be evaluated.
How are foundation cracks rep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ks, underpinning, or installing reinforcement to restore stability.
When should a property owner seek repair services? Repairs are recommended when cracks are wide, active, or accompanied by other signs of foundation movement.
